How cold does Annapolis get?

December 14, 2021 by Sadie Daniel

In Annapolis, the summers are warm and muggy; the winters are very cold, snowy, and windy; and it is partly cloudy year round. Over the course of the year, the temperature typically varies from 29°F to 85°F and is rarely below 17°F or above 91°F. Does Annapolis get a lot of snow? Annapolis averages 12 […]

Why is Baltimore not part of a county?

December 14, 2021 by Sadie Daniel

The City of Baltimore has been separate from Baltimore County, Maryland since the adoption of the Maryland Constitution of 1851. Carson City, Nevada consolidated with Ormsby County in 1969, and the county was simultaneously dissolved. Is Baltimore city in a county? Though an independent city rather than a county, the City of Baltimore is considered […]

Does Annapolis have an Amtrak station?

December 14, 2021 by Trevor Zboncak

Washington Metrorail System (WMATA) – Primary access to/from Annapolis is New Carrollton Metro Station (the Orange Line). Amtrak (rail passenger service) can be accessed at the New Carrollton Metro Station, at Penn Station in Baltimore, or in downtown Washington at Union Station.
